Islamabad: Capital Development Authority (CDA) has started regularization of Zone-IV and Banigala on the court directions.
Prime Minister Imran Khan has given application for the regularization of both of his residences, including a 250 Kanal residence and adjacent drawing room building.
CDA has received 132 applications from the commercial and residential owners for Zone-IV and Banigala, CDA administration after court direction started the process of regularization.
According to sources, the map and other documents of PM’s residence has been submitted to CDA one window for regularization.
CDA will charge Rs100/square feet from residential and 200 from commercial buildings, the owners of commercial building would also bound to pay commercialization charges Rs 3500 per square feet and Zone-4 residents would also pay the developmental charges.
